掌握数据动态生成HTML,前端高效开发!

在前端开发中,动态生成HTML是一项非常重要的技能。它可以让我们更加灵活地控制网页的结构和内容,实现更好的用户体验。本文将从8个方面详细介绍前端如何通过数据动态生成HTML。

1.什么是动态生成HTML

动态生成HTML是指根据数据和逻辑,在网页加载时生成HTML代码。相比于静态HTML,动态生成HTML可以更加灵活地控制网页内容和结构,提高用户体验。

2.数据驱动的思想

在动态生成HTML中,数据驱动的思想非常重要。即将数据作为输入,通过逻辑处理后生成对应的HTML代码。这种思想可以让我们更加专注于数据和逻辑层面,提高开发效率。

3.模板引擎

模板引擎是实现动态生成HTML的一种常用工具。它通过预定义的模板和数据进行渲染,最终输出对应的HTML代码。目前市面上有很多优秀的模板引擎可供选择,如Handlebars、Mustache等。

4. DOM操作

除了使用模板引擎外,我们还可以通过DOM操作来实现动态生成HTML。DOM操作可以让我们直接控制网页的结构和内容,实现更加精细的控制。但是需要注意的是,DOM操作也可能会影响性能,需要谨慎使用。

5. AJAX请求

在动态生成HTML中,AJAX请求也是非常重要的一环。通过发送异步请求获取数据后,再根据逻辑生成对应的HTML代码,可以实现更加灵活的数据展示效果。

6.数据格式化

在动态生成HTML过程中,数据格式化也是非常重要的一环。通过将数据格式化为符合需求的格式,可以更加方便地进行渲染和展示。常见的数据格式化方式有日期格式化、货币格式化等。

7.组件化开发

组件化开发是一种优秀的前端开发思想。通过将页面拆分为多个组件,每个组件只关注自己的逻辑和展示效果,可以大大提高代码可维护性和复用性。

8.性能优化

在动态生成HTML过程中,性能优化也是非常重要的一环。需要注意减少不必要的DOM操作、避免重复渲染等问题,提高网页加载速度和用户体验。

本文介绍了前端如何通过数据动态生成HTML,并从8个方面详细讨论了相关技术和思想。相信读者通过本文可以更好地掌握动态生成HTML的技巧和方法,提高开发效率和用户体验。

声明:本站所有文章,如无特殊说明或标注,均为本站原创发布。任何个人或组织,在未征得本站同意时,禁止复制、盗用、采集、发布本站内容到任何网站、书籍等各类媒体平台。如若本站内容侵犯了原著者的合法权益,可联系我们进行处理。
0 条回复 A文章作者 M管理员
    暂无讨论,说说你的看法吧
Slide
关于我们

公司介绍

公司团队

加入我们

相关平台

软柠账号

支持

客服

云服务

本站

官方账号

投资者关系

公告

博客文章

联系方式

微信:Ubigsea

邮箱:service@devskyr.com

举报:w@rnkj.cc

合作:zcn@rnkj.cc

我们的业务

高速云盘

枫汇快传

外包开发

解决方案定制

代理建站

合作相关

软件合作

广告投放

项目合作

其它合作

友情链接

创峄信息科技

软柠科技

夏雨社区

鸡享域分发

致谢

BBer(平滑JS)

AseBlur(组件共创)

联合名单

进入名单 →

版权归属所有权©2018-2024上海枫汇网络科技有限公司/杭州软柠科技有限公司。保留所有权利。

服务协议 | Cookie政策 | 服务条款 | 法律声明 | 主方:沪ICP备2022008782号-7 | 运营方(软柠科技)浙公网安备33010802013612号